Signal Image Process Engineer Stf - E4
Overview
In this role you will apply advanced image and signal processing to support missile and fire control programs. You will work within a skilled systems engineering and algorithm team to research, design, and validate processing algorithms for sensor data. You will develop architectures and subsystems, and lead or contribute to projects that deliver robust target detection and information extraction. The role offers exposure to HWIL testing, modeling, and simulations in complex, real-time environments with broad impact on mission-critical systems.
